Nidek OPD Scan III Wavefront Aberrometry
Nidek OPD Scan III Wavefront Aberrometry is a multiple-instrument device combining corneal topography, wavefront aberrometry, autorefraction, keratometry, pupillometry, and pupillography. The measurement of topography and whole eye wavefront allows separation of corneal and internal aberrations for rapid assessment of the refractive and optical effects of the cornea, physiologic lens, or an intraocular lens. The Daya Cataract Summary, the Cataract Summary, the Optical Quality summary, the Internal OPD, toric summary, and retroillumination maps are described.
Features :
Five-in-One Vision Examination: The unique OPD-Scan III is an advanced vision assessment system that combines topography, wavefront, automated refractor, keratometry, and pupillometry.
Detailed Patient Summaries: The OPD-Scan offers multiple map summaries to suit you practice or clinical requirements with easy-to-understand patient reports and even more details for comprehensive vision analysis.
Enhanced Measurement Accuracy: 33 blue placido mires provide a minimum of 11,880 data points which is more than 170% of the OPD-Scan II. The blue wavelength allows greater precision in ring detection. The reduced illumination creates a comfortable patient experience.
Final Fit Software: The optional Final Fit software evaluates and converts the OPD-Scan III’s refractive and topographic data to produce the precise customized ablation parameters for the NIDEK EC Quest Excimer Laser System.

SPECIFICATIONS:
| Power Mapping | |
|---|---|
| Spherical Power Range | -20.00 to +22.00 D |
| Cylindrical Power | 0.00 to ±12.00 D |
| Axis | 0 to 180° |
| Measurement Area | 2.0 to 9.5 mm (7 zone measurement) |
| Data Points | 2,520 points (7 x 360) |
| Measuring time | < 1.0 seconds |
| Measurement Method | Automated objective refraction (dynamic skiascopy) |
| Mapping Methods | OPD, Internal OPD, Wavefront maps, Zernike graph, PSF, MTF graph, Visual Acuity Corneal Topography |
| Measurement Rings | 33 vertical, 39 horizontal |
| Measurement Area | 0.5 to 11.0 mm (r = 7.9) |
| Dioptric Range | 33.75 to 67.5 D |
| Axis Range | 0 to 359˚ |
| Data Points | More than 11,880 |
| Mapping Methods | Axial, Instantaneous, “Refractive”, Elevation, Wavefront maps, Zernike graph, PSF, MTF graph, Visual Acuity General Information |
| Working Distance | 75 mm |
| Auto Tracking | X-Y-Z directions |
| Observation Area | 14 x 11 mm |
